Welcome to Kathwood ...

Kathwood is located in Aiken County<1>.


The location of Kathwood has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<2>


While we don't have a date for the founding of Kathwood,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1898.

Kathwood is 130 feet [40 m] above sea level.<3>.

Time Zone: Kathwood l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time

Kathwood lies within the (803) area code.

Communities Also Named Kathwood ...

Using our Gazetteer, we found that there are two South Carolina communities named Kathwood: This one is located in Aiken County and the other is located in Lexington County.

Adding Kathwood to Our Gazetteer ...

We originally found mention of Kathwood in both the FIPS-55 and the GNIS. For more information, see the FIPS and GNIS Codes sections on our Miscellaneous Page.

From our notes, the earliest published mention we've found for Kathwood was in the document titled List of Post Offices from Cameron Blevins and Richard Helbock.<5>

From that list, the Kathwood post office opened in 1898.

We also found Kathwood on a map titled Rand McNally Map of South Carolina (1911).
